#e42462 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e42462 is composed of 89.4% red, 14.1%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 57%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 340.6 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 51.8%. #e42462 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48c4 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e42462 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e42462 has RGB values of R:228, G:36,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.57,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14951522.

Shades and Tints of #e42462
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e42462
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858384 is the less saturated color, while #f7115b is the most saturated one.
